In the fast-paced world of business, efficiency and accuracy in financial management are paramount. QuickBooks Online (QBO) has emerged as a leading cloud-based accounting solution, offering a plethora of features designed to streamline financial operations. One of the most valuable capabilities of QBO is its ability to import transactions directly from Excel spreadsheets, a feature that can save businesses considerable time and reduce the risk of data entry errors. This article provides a comprehensive guide on how to import transactions into QuickBooks Online from Excel, ensuring a smooth and successful integration of your financial data.

Understanding The Basics

Before delving into the import process, it's crucial to understand the types of transactions that can be imported into QBO from Excel. These include bank transactions, credit card transactions, invoices, bills, and more. Preparing your Excel spreadsheet correctly is a key step in ensuring a seamless import process.

Preparing Your Excel Spreadsheet for Import

  1. Format Your Data: Ensure your Excel spreadsheet is formatted correctly. QuickBooks Online has specific requirements for the format of the data being imported. Typically, this includes columns for the date, description, amount, and other relevant details depending on the type of transaction.
  2. Check for Errors: Before importing, carefully review your spreadsheet for any errors or inconsistencies, such as incorrect dates, duplicate entries, or mismatched amounts. Correcting these issues beforehand will prevent problems during the import process.
  3. Save Your Spreadsheet: Once your data is formatted and checked, save your Excel spreadsheet in a format compatible with QuickBooks Online, usually .xlsx or .csv.

Importing Transactions Into QuickBooks Online

  1. Access the Import Data Feature: Log in to your QuickBooks Online account. Navigate to the "Settings" menu (often represented by a gear icon), and select "import transactions into QuickBooks online " from the options available.
  2. Choose the Type of Transaction: You will be presented with a list of data types that can be imported. Select the type of transaction you wish to import (e.g., "Bank Data," "Invoices," etc.).
  3. Upload Your Excel File: Click on "Browse" to locate and select the Excel file you prepared earlier. Once selected, click on "Next" to proceed.
  4. Map Your Data: QuickBooks Online will require you to map the columns in your Excel spreadsheet to the corresponding fields in QBO. This step is crucial for ensuring that the data from your spreadsheet is accurately reflected in your QuickBooks account. Follow the on-screen instructions to map your data correctly.
  5. Review and Import: After mapping your data, review the information to ensure everything is correct. Pay close attention to any warnings or errors that QuickBooks Online may flag. Once satisfied, proceed to import your data by clicking on the "Import" button.
  6. Post-Import Review: Once the import is complete, it's important to review your transactions within QuickBooks Online to ensure that all data has been imported correctly and is reflected accurately in your account.

Tips for a Successful Import

  1. Backup Your Data: Before making significant changes or imports, always back up your QuickBooks Online data to prevent any potential loss of information.
  2. Use Templates: For recurring imports, consider creating and saving Excel templates that match the required format for QuickBooks Online. This can save time and reduce errors in future imports.
  3. Stay Updated: QuickBooks Online periodically updates its platform and import capabilities. Stay informed about any changes that might affect how you prepare and import your Excel spreadsheets.
  4. Seek Support: If you encounter difficulties during the import process, don't hesitate to seek support. QuickBooks Online offers extensive help resources, including articles, tutorials, and customer support services.


Importing transactions into QuickBooks Online from Excel can significantly enhance the efficiency of your financial management processes. By following the steps outlined in this guide, you can ensure a smooth and accurate import of your financial data. Remember, preparation and attention to detail are key to a successful import. With practice and familiarity, importing transactions from Excel to QuickBooks Online will become a streamlined component of your financial management toolkit, enabling you to focus more on growing your business and less on manual data entry.